Caption: Federal Advance
Additional Description: Looking west from the high ground near the marker location. The Col. Sideny Burbank's Brigade was at the fore of the attack. Burbank's men were U.S. Regulars: the 2nd, 6th, 7th, 10th, 11th and 17th U.S. Infantry. Their line was roughly straddling what is today the walking trail, but with elements both north and south of the Pike (seen to the left). Behind and to the right of Burbank was the brigade of Col. Patrick O'Rourke, the 5th, 140th, and 146th New York Infantry. To the left (north) of Burbank was another Brigade of U.S. Regulars under General Romeyn Ayres - the 3rd, 4th, 12th and 14th U.S. Infantry.
